Building a Powerful VoIP Application from Scratch

Crafting a robust telephony system from scratch is a complex undertaking. It requires a deep understanding of networking standards, audio encoding, and real-time communication.

Programmers must carefully choose the suitable technologies to ensure a seamless with high-crystal-clear audio performance. A well-designed VoIP application must be flexible to accommodate diverse user loads. Security is also essential, as VoIP systems transmit sensitive information.

Prioritizing ease of use is crucial to create an application that is straightforward for a broad range of individuals.

Streamlining Communication with Custom VoIP Application Development

In today's dynamic business landscape, efficient communication is paramount for success. Traditional phone systems can often fall short in meeting the demanding needs of modern organizations. Custom VoIP application development offers a powerful solution to streamline communication and enhance productivity. By leveraging the flexibility and scalability of VoIP technology, businesses can create applications that are precisely tailored to their unique requirements.

With a custom VoIP app, you can introduce features such as instant messaging, video conferencing, call recording, and automated call routing, all within a user-friendly interface. This not only expedites communication but also reduces costs associated with traditional phone lines and infrastructure.
